Commercial Masonry Service in Cleveland, OH
Commercial masonry services encompass a range of construction and repair projects involving the use of brick, stone, concrete blocks, and other durable materials. Property owners often request these services for building or restoring features such as retaining walls, building facades, entryways, parking garages, and decorative facades for commercial buildings. Understanding the scope of the project, the types of materials suitable for the specific application, and the structural requirements are important considerations before requesting commercial masonry work. Proper planning ensures that the finished project enhances the property's appearance, functionality, and longevity.
Before requesting commercial masonry services, property owners typically want to know about the durability and maintenance needs of different materials, as well as the overall process involved in construction or repair. It’s also helpful to consider the architectural style of the property and any local building codes or regulations that may influence the project. Clear communication about project goals, budget, and timeline can help ensure the work aligns with expectations and results in a lasting, professional finish.

Commercial Masonry Service Questions
What types of masonry projects are common for commercial properties? Typical projects include building or restoring brick facades, retaining walls, and decorative stonework for storefronts and office buildings.
Can commercial masonry services improve the durability of a building? Yes, proper masonry work enhances structural integrity and resistance to weathering, helping buildings last longer.
What materials are used in commercial masonry services? Common materials include brick, concrete block, stone, and veneer, chosen for their strength and aesthetic appeal.
Is commercial masonry suitable for both new construction and renovation? Yes, masonry services support both new builds and updates to existing structures to improve appearance and stability.
